To celebrate our favorite films on Oscar night, my boyfriend, my sister, her boyfriend and I whipped up a golden bowl of classic Thai flavors. We cooked and ate to a playlist of glamorous, Hollywood-inspired tunes. Some came straight out of our favorite flicks from 2014 and years past!
WHAT YOU’LL NEED
FOR THE SOUP
» 4 cups water
» 3 cups fresh spinach leaves
» ½ lb snow peas, trimmed and halved
» 1 8-oz package udon noodles
» 1 Tbsp canola oil
» ¼ cup shallots, thinly sliced
» 2 tsp red curry paste
» 1 ½ tsp curry powder
» ½ tsp ground turmeric
» 2 cloves garlic, minced
» 6 cups veggie broth
» 1 14-oz can light coconut milk
» about ½ pound cooked and shredded chicken (or tofu)
» ½ cup green onions, chopped
» 2 Tbsp soy sauce
» salt to taste
POSSIBLE GARNISHES
» fresh mint
» crushed red pepper flakes
» lime wedges
WHAT TO DO
Bring 4 cups of water to a boil in a medium sized pot. Add the spinach and peas to the pot and cook for 30 seconds.
Remove vegetables from the pot with a slotted spoon and transfer to a bowl. Cook the noodles until al dente, give them a drain, and add them to veggie mixture.
Heat the canola oil in a heavy-bottomed pot over medium-high heat. Toss in the shallots and spices, and sauté for about a minute, stirring constantly. Add the veggie broth to the pot and bring to a boil.
Add the coconut milk, soy sauce, and green onions to the pot, reduce the heat, and simmer 5 minutes.
Portion the peas, spinach, noodles, and chicken and/or tofu into individual bowls.
Ladle the broth into the bowls then top with mint, crushed red pepper, green onions, and a lime wedge. Enjoy!
